Mich. Comp. Laws § 458.530

United Missionary churches; powers of trustees

1949, Act 265, Eff

Sec. 10. The trustees shall have power, according to the terms and limitations of the discipline of the United Missionary church, as from time to time authorized and declared by the annual conference of said church, to purchase, build, repair, lease, rent, mortgage or encumber its property: Provided, That in case of selling or disposing of real estate, the consent of the annual conference be obtained.
